WebFraoch Heather AleWilliams Brothers Brewing Company. Notes: Brewed in Scotland since 2000 B.C. heather ale is probably the oldest style of ale still produced in the world. WebSep 16, 2024 · Method 1 Standard Cheers 1 Exclaim "Sláinte!" This is the closest term you can use to toast someone "cheers!" in Irish Gaelic. More accurately, the term "sláinte" translates into the English term "health." When using this term, you are essentially toasting to someone's health. Pronounce this Irish term as slawn-cha.
